Changing Trends at ThyssenKrupp
ThyssenKrupp manufactures and configures custom elevators. To shorten sales cycles, reduce costs, and simplify ordering for agencies, distributors, and customers, Implementing the Cameleon Commerce Suite e-commerce platform and product configurator. Energy Efficient IT : The Intel's Way
Reducing energy consumption and CO2 emissions in power-hungry areas like IT is becoming of paramount importance to companies all over the globe. Together with long-standing technology partner Intel, BMW Group set out a roadmap titled E2IT (Energy Efficient IT) for improving the energy efficiency and effectiveness of its IT infrastructure. Managing firms throughout the business cycle: The Davis Way!
The first decade of the 21st century has been a rollercoaster ride for economic activity. Business confidence was high at the start of the millennium. This was particularly fuelled by the growth of the internet as a means of buying and selling. A lot of companies have developed websites and there has been a rapid increase in online purchasing. during 2008/9 the rapid growth of world markets came to a halt. Many of the problems stemmed from banks lending money to risky borrowers. When some of these failed to pay back this led to a rapid loss of confidence in the banking system. Banks became reluctant to lend. The Davis Service Group provides textile maintenance services in the UK and Europe. This includes linen hire, work-wear rental, dust control mat, laundry and washroom services. The Group consists of two main operating companies each with its own directors and executive team. These two operating companies delegate responsibility and authority to profit centres throughout the Group.
